For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 199 students in Kirby School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public high schools in Arkansas.
Public High School in Kirby School District have an average math proficiency score of 17% (versus the Arkansas public high school average of 30%), and reading proficiency score of 27% (versus the 40% statewide average).
Public High School in Kirby School District have a Graduation Rate of 80%, which is less than the Arkansas average of 88%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Kirby High School, with ≥80%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Arkansas or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 18%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Arkansas public high school average of 41% (majority Black).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$12,186 in this school district is less than the state median of $13,132.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$10,586 is less than the state median of $13,043.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
